Transaction eee2265781309ff3d1c6be72186629add035c956a3a064a81697c3041d5fa031
1 Input
1 Output
-
eee2265781309ff3d1c6be72186629add035c956a3a064a81697c3041d5fa031:0
- value
- 1059388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f08c9afe37ca90becc760340a18e0c3732381a7 OP_EQUAL
- address
- 334Wb1bQZKGSkJDwJrkLFdGF2bWVnG9YGV